Best Schools in Spicer, OR
Spicer, OR has a total of 8 schools including 2 high schools, 4 middle schools and 2 elementary schools. A total of 5,568 students attend Spicer, OR schools. On average, schools in Spicer score 24% on their proficiency tests, and we project an average score of 36%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, schools in Spicer underperform expectations.

Education & Community Snapshot in Spicer, OR
City-level factors that shape the learning environment around local schools.
Community Factors
Spicer, OR has a total population of 948 with 18% of that population attending schools. The adult high school graduation rate is 87%, and 18%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her.
